matlab任意生成一个三维实体模型,并将结果保存成 emf 图片格式
时间: 2024-03-21 11:39:21 浏览: 165
用Matlab绘制模型
4星 · 用户满意度95%
好的,我可以为您提供一些代码示例来生成三维实体模型,并将其保存为 emf 图片格式。请注意,由于我是一个文本处理程序,我无法直接生成三维实体模型,但我可以告诉您如何使用 Matlab 中的工具来生成模型和保存图像。
以下是示例代码:
```matlab
% 生成一个三维实体模型
[X,Y,Z] = meshgrid(-2:0.2:2);
V = X .* exp(-X.^2 - Y.^2 - Z.^2);
% 将模型显示为等值面图
figure;
isosurface(X,Y,Z,V,0.4);
axis equal;
% 将图像保存为 emf 格式
print('example.emf', '-dmeta');
```
这段代码将生成一个三维实体模型,并将其显示为等值面图。然后,它使用 `print` 函数将图像保存为 emf 格式文件。您可以将 `example.emf` 替换为您希望使用的文件名。
请注意,要使用 `print` 函数将图像保存为 emf 格式文件,您需要有一个支持 emf 格式的打印机驱动程序。如果您的计算机上没有安装此驱动程序,则无法保存为 emf 格式文件。
阅读全文